摘要
【摘要】探讨孤独症谱系障碍(ASD)患儿血清25羟维生素D[25(OH)D]、叶酸水平及临床意义。方法 纳入2018年2月-2020年2月我院200例ASD患儿,设为ASD组,并按病情分为轻中度(132)与重度组(68),选择年龄、性别配对的同期入院体检的200例正常儿童为对照组,比较两组血清25(OH)D、叶酸及叶酸代谢产物叶酸受体自身抗体(FRAA)以及5-甲基四氢叶酸(5-MTHF)水平。结果 ASD组血清25(OH)D、叶酸、5-MTHF水平显著低于对照组,FRAA水平、儿童孤独症评定量表(CARS)显著高于对照组,(P<0.05);重度组血清25(OH)D、叶酸、5-MTHF水平显著低于轻中度组,FRAA水平、CARS评分显著高于轻中度组,(P<0.05);血清25(OH)D、叶酸、5-MTHF水平与CARS评分呈负相关,FRAA水平与CARS评分呈正相关,(P<0.05)。结论 ASD的发病与病情进展可能与25(OH)D、叶酸缺乏以及代谢紊乱有关,可据此开展靶向营养或药物干预进行ASD的辅助治疗或预防。
Abstract
[Abstract] Objective To explore the serum 25-hydroxyvitamin D [25(OH)D], folate levels and clinical significance of children with autism spectrum disorder (ASD). Methods A total of 200 children with ASD in our hospital from February 2018 to February 2020 were included in the ASD group, and divided into light moderate group (132) and severe group (68) according to the condition. 200 normal children who were admitted to the hospital during the same period of age and gender were selected as the control group. Serum 25(OH)D, folate and folate metabolite folate receptor autoantibodies (FRAA) and 5-methyltetrahydrofolate (5-MTHF) were compared between the two groups. Results The levels of serum 25(OH)D, folic acid and 5-MTHF in the ASD group were significantly lower than those in the control group, and the FRAA levels and Child Autism Rating Scale (CARS) were significantly higher than those in the control group (P<0.05). The levels of serum 25(OH)D, folic acid and 5-MTHF in the severe group were significantly lower than those in the mild-moderate group, and the FRAA levels and CARS scores were significantly higher than those in the mild-moderate group (P<0.05). Serum 25(OH)D, folic acid and 5-MTHF levels were negatively correlated with CARS scores, and FRAA levels were positively correlated with CARS scores (P<0.05). Conclusion The onset and progression of ASD may be related to 25(OH)D, folic acid deficiency, and metabolic disorders, which can be used to carry out targeted nutrition or drug intervention for adjuvant treatment or prevention of ASD.
